What a mess this program has become.
1. I have setup Spybot to protect my homepage from being hijacked. Ad-Aware
SE detected this as a browser hijack attempt.
2. I also have Spybot set to prevent Internet Options from being opened in
Internet Explorer. Ad-Aware SE also detected this as a browser hijack
attempt.
3. In my Favorites folder I have two sites that perform a reverse telephone
book lookups. One for Canada, the other for the USA. Ad-Aware SE identified
these 2 URLs as problematic and possible homepage hijack attempts.
4. This was the worst. When I decided to try a complete scan (I performed a
smart scan first) within a few minutes AVG popped up with:
Virus
Virus Identified Java/Byte Verify
is found in file
C:\DOCUME~1\USERNAME~1\Temp\AATWTMP\C2365468\Counter.class
I ran a Complete Scan with AVG but it found nothing. So I tried running
another complete scan with Ad-Aware SE. Sure enough AVG came up with the
same message again. I have never seen this message before. I had run a
Complete Scan with AVG only a couple of hours before downloading Ad-Aware
SE, no problems were found. I have now uninstalled Ad-Aware SE.
